African Ports Evolution

The premiere maritime forum in Africa providing attendees with take home, future-proofed solutions for boosting the integrity of port operations, modernising facilities, and increasing bulk and container throughput. The forum aims to discover the scale of planned marine development and expansion projects across the African continent. It provides proven alternative solutions for demand driven port development and expansion, creating productive ports and terminals and supportive networks to fast-track Africa's economic development.

90% of all trade in Africa is done via its ports. This has resulted in major developments and investments in ports cities like Durban, Accra and Mombassa, just to name a few. At this year's African Ports Evolution 2016, we will be focusing on major port development to accommodate Ultra Large Vessels (ULCV) - the main reason for most of the port upgrades in Africa. We will also focus on container delivery and clearance time to make your port more efficient and to streamline your port through technology inputs.
